Rafael Fiziev Gets His Wish, Booked For Rematch With Justin Gaethje
By FCF Staff
Justin Gaethje is remaining on the UFC 313 card, as Rafael Fiziev has been granted his wish, and will rematch the longtime, lightweight contender.
Gaethje had been booked to fight Dan Hooker at the March 8th event, but a hand injury has forced him to withdraw. When news of his withdrawal broke, Fiziev called for the UFC to tap him as a replacement and more recently the promotion announced the rematch is official.
Fiziev (12-3) faced Gaethje for the first time in March, 2023, and lost the fight via decision. The noted striker hasn’t competed since September, 2023, when he dropped a decision loss to Mateuz Gamrot.
Gaethje (25-5), meanwhile, is coming off a highlight reel, KO loss to Max Holloway, in April, 2024.
UFC 313 will be headlined by a light-heavyweight fight between champion Alex Pereira and Magomed Ankalaev.
The card will be hosted by T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as, Nevada.
